\t明日科技编著的《Java从入门到精通(第3版)》以初、中级程序员为对象,先从Java语言基础学起,再学习Java的核心技术,然后学习Swing的高级应用,最后学习开发一个完整项目。
\t书中每一章节均提供声图并茂的语音视频教学视频,读者可以根据书中提供的视频位置在光盘中找到。这些视频能够引导初学者快速入门,感受编程的快乐和成就感,增强进一步学习的信心,从而快速成为编程高手。
网站首页 软件下载 游戏下载 翻译软件 电子书下载 电影下载 电视剧下载 教程攻略
书名 | Java从入门到精通(附光盘第3版)/软件开发视频大讲堂 |
分类 | |
作者 | 明日科技 |
出版社 | 清华大学出版社 |
下载 | ![]() |
简介 | 编辑推荐
内容推荐 ??明日科技编著的《Java从入门到精通(第3版)》从初学者角度出发,通过通俗易懂的语言、丰富多彩的实例,详细介绍了使用Java语言进行程序开发需要掌握的知识。全书分为28章,包括初识Java,熟悉Eclipse开发工具,Java语言基础,流程控制,字符串,数组,类和对象,包装类,数字处理类,接口、继承与多态,类的高级特性,异常处理,Swing程序设计,集合类,I/O(输入/输出),反射,枚举类型与泛型,多线程,网络通信,数据库操作,Swing表格组件,Swing树组件,Swing其他高级组件,高级布局管理器,高级事件处理,AWT绘图与音频播放,打印技术和企业进销存管理系统等。书中所有知识都结合具体实例进行介绍,涉及的程序代码给出了详细的注释,可以使读者轻松领会Java程序开发的精髓,快速提高开发技能。另外,本书除了纸质内容之外,配书光盘中还给出了海量开发资源库,主要内容如下: ??语音视频讲解:总时长32小时,共312段 ??实例资源库:732个实例及源码详细分析 ??模块资源库:15个经典模块开发过程完整展现 ??项目案例资源库:15个企业项目开发过程完整展现 ??测试题库系统:616道能力测试题目 ??面试资源库:369个企业面试真题 ??PPT电子教案 ??《Java从入门到精通(第3版)》适合作为软件开发入门者的自学用书,也适合作为高等院校相关专业的教学参考书,也可供开发人员查阅、参考。 目录 第1篇?基础知识 ?第1章?初识Java ??视频讲解:34分钟 ??1.1?Java简介 ???1.1.1?什么是Java语言 ???1.1.2?Java的应用领域 ???1.1.3?Java的版本 ???1.1.4?怎样学好Java ???1.1.5?JavaAPI文档 ??1.2?Java语言的特性 ???1.2.1?简单 ???1.2.2?面向对象 ???1.2.3?分布性 ???1.2.4?可移植性 ???1.2.5?解释型 ???1.2.6?安全性 ???1.2.7?健壮性 ???1.2.8?多线程 ???1.2.9?高性能 ???1.2.10?动态 ??1.3?搭建Java环境 ???1.3.1?JDK下载 ???1.3.2?Windows系统的JDK环境 ??1.4?第一个Java程序 ??1.5?小结 ??1.6?实践与练习 ?第2章?熟悉Eclipse开发工具 ?第3章?Java语言基础 ?第4章?流程控制 ?第5章?字符串 ?第6章?数组 ?第7章?类和对象 ?第8章?包装类 ?第9章?数字处理类 第2篇?核心技术 第3篇?高级应用 第4篇?项目实战 试读章节 1.2.1 简单 Java语言的语法简单明了,容易掌握,而且是纯面向对象的语言。Java语言的简单性主要体现在以下几个方面: 语法规则和C++类似。从某种意义上讲,Java语言是由C和C什语言转变而来的,所以C程序设计人员可以很容易地掌握Java语言的语法。 Java语言对C什进行了简化和提高。例如,Java使用接口取代了多重继承,并取消了指针,因为指针和多重继承通常使程序变得复杂。Java语言还通过实现垃圾自动收集,大大简化了程序设计人员的资源释放管理工作。 Java提供了丰富的类库和API文档以及第三方开发包,另外还有大量的基于Java的开源项目,JDK(Java开发者工具箱)已经开放源代码,读者可以通过分析项目的源代码,从而提高自己的编程水平。 1.2.2面向对象 面向对象是Java语言的基础,也是Java语言的重要特性,它本身就是一种纯面向对象的程序设计语言。Java提倡万物皆对象,语法中不能在类外面定义单独的数据和函数,也就是说,Java语言最外部的数据类型是对象,所有的元素都要通过类和对象来访问。 1.2.3 分布性 Java的分布性包括操作分布和数据分布,其中操作分布是指在多个不同的主机上布置相关操作,而数据分布是将数据分别存放在多个不同的主机上,这些主机是网络中的不同成员。Java可以凭借URL(统一资源定位符)对象访问网络对象,访问方式与访问本地系统相同。 1.2.4可移植性 Java程序具有与体系结构无关的特性,可以方便地移植到网络上的不同计算机中。同时,Java的类库中也实现了针对不同平台的接口,使这些类库可以移植。 1.2.5 解释型 运行Java程序需要解释器。任何移植了Java解释器的计算机或其他设备都可以用Java字节码进行解释执行。字节码独立于平台,它本身携带了许多编译时的信息,使得连接过程更加简单,开发过程更加迅速,更具探索性。 1.2.6 安全性 Java语言删除了类似C语言中的指针和内存释放等语法,有效地避免了非法操作内存。Java程序代码要经过代码校验、指针校验等很多测试步骤才能够运行,所以未经允许的Java程序不可能出现损害系统平台的行为,而且使用Java可以编写防病毒和防修改的系统。 序言
|
随便看 |
|
霍普软件下载网电子书栏目提供海量电子书在线免费阅读及下载。